A man drove his van into a tent where six people were registering people to vote. There were no injuries, but six of the volunteers were nearly hit, including one woman who said he missed her by six inches.



Gregory William Loel Timm, 27, was arrested by law enforcement with the Jacksonville Sheriff’s Office and charged with two counts of aggravated assault on a person 65 years of age or older, one count of criminal mischief and driving with a suspended license.

The tent, set up by the Jacksonville Republican Party, had “Trump 2020” signs on it as well as the table that Timm reportedly ran over. Witnesses say he drove by, then turned around and started driving slowly towards the tent before “gunning it” directly at them. After narrowly missing the people there, he stopped his van, got out, filmed them with his cell phone, and made obscene gestures towards them before driving off.
